    Fans have been urged to move fast if they want to see Mumford & Sons live this summer, as general sale finally kicks off in the US.

    The British folk rock band announced a 32-date North America tour to celebrate new album Rushmere, set to commence in June 2025.

    Making it a tour to remember, the likes of Japanese Breakfast, Gregory Alan Isakov, and Michael Kiwanuka, will join the group on tour as support acts for the American stint.

    Where are Mumford & Sons performing in North America this year?

    There’s plenty of chance to see Mumford & Sons on tour this year with stops in the likes of Los Angeles, Chicago, Philadelphia, and Nashville. The band will hit the road on June 5 and will wrap things up on October 26. You can find out if Mumford & Sons are heading to a city near you below. See you there?

    You can find a full list of 2025 tour dates below:

    • June 5: Bend, Hayden Homes Amphitheater
    • June 9: Berkeley, The Greek Theatre
    • June 12: Los Angeles, Hollywood Bowl
    • June 14: West Valley City, Utah First Credit Union Amphitheatre
    • June 17: Noblesville, Ruoff Music Center
    • June 18: Cuyahoga Falls, Blossom Music Center
    • June 20: Mansfield, Xfinity Center
    • June 21: Saratoga Springs, Broadview Stage at SPAC
    • June 22: Columbia, Merriweather Post Pavilion
    • June 24: Toronto, Budweiser Stage
    • July 18: Quincy, The Gorge Amphitheatre
    • July 19: Whitefish, Under The Big Sky Festival
    • July 21: Morrison, Red Rocks Amphitheatre
    • July 22: Morrison, Red Rocks Amphitheatre
    • July 24: Bonner Springs, Azura Amphitheater
    • July 26: Alpharetta, Ameris Bank Amphitheatre
    • July 27: Charleston, Credit One Stadium
    • July 29: Raleigh, Coastal Credit Union Music Park
    • July 31: Huntsville, Orion Amphitheater
    • August 8: Forest Hills, Forest Hills Stadium
    • October 8: Chicago, United Center
    • October 9: St. Paul, Xcel Energy Center
    • October 11: Milwaukee, Fiserv Forum
    • October 12: Columbus, Nationwide Arena
    • October 14: Philadelphia, Wells Fargo Center
    • October 16: Buffalo, KeyBank Center
    • October 17: Montréal, Centre Bell
    • October 19: Pittsburgh, PPG Paints Arena
    • October 20: Detroit, Little Caesars Arena
    • October 22: Nashville, Bridgestone Arena
    • October 24: Austin, Moody Center
    • October 25: Tulsa, BOK Center
    • October 26: Omaha, CHI Health Center Arena
